SYNOPSIS:
A cryptic message from the past sends James Bond on a rogue mission to Mexico City and eventually Rome, where he meets Lucia Sciarra (Monica Bellucci), the beautiful and forbidden widow of an infamous criminal. Bond infiltrates a secret meeting and uncovers the existence of the sinister organisation known as SPECTRE. 
Meanwhile back in London, Max Denbigh (Andrew Scott), the new head of the Centre for National Security, questions Bond’s actions and challenges the relevance of MI6, led by M (Ralph Fiennes). Bond covertly enlists Moneypenny (Naomie Harris) and Q (Ben Whishaw) to help him seek out Madeleine Swann (Léa Seydoux), the daughter of his old nemesis Mr White (Jesper Christensen), who may hold the clue to untangling the web of SPECTRE. As the daughter of an assassin, she understands Bond in a way most others cannot. 
As Bond ventures towards the heart of SPECTRE, he learns of a chilling connection between himself and the enemy he seeks, played by Christoph Waltz.

MGM, Fox Announce THE ULTIMATE JAMES BOND Collection With Limited Steelbooks And More!


There's no doubt that fans of the James Bond franchise will forsee the release of director Sam Mendes's latest contribution, Spectre. In the meantime, MGM and Fox are preparing to re-release all 23 films from the franchise for a limited edition steel book release this September with all the trimmings, including debut digital release copies and exclusive new featurettes to introduce the franchise in lieu of the upcoming new film arriving two months thereafter.

Read all the important specs you need to know below and pre-order your copy today
As fans prepare for the November 6th release of SPECTRE, Metro-Goldwyn-Mayer Studios (MGM) and Twentieth Century Fox Home Entertainment will release an all-new line-up of special edition Blu-rays, DVDs and box-sets on September 15th. 
Two never-before-seen featurettes are included with interviews from Bond writers Neal Purvis and Robert Wade. “The Shadow of SPECTRE” will recount the fictional history of the global criminal syndicate and terrorist organization, “The Story So Far” will provide an overview of Daniel Craig’s first three Bond movies. 
Six films featuring the SPECTRE organization (FROM RUSSIA WITH LOVE, THUNDERBALL, YOU ONLY LIVE TWICE, ON HER MAJESTY’S SECRET SERVICE, DIAMONDS ARE FOREVER, FOR YOUR EYES ONLY) and the three recent Daniel Craig titles (CASINO ROYALE, QUANTUM OF SOLACE, SKYFALL) will each get a limited edition Blu-ray Steelbook release, their cover designs inspired by each film’s opening title sequence. 
Or Bond fans can choose from Actor Packs on Blu-ray and DVD, with newly-designed packaging. 
Finally, The Ultimate James Bond Collection will feature all 23 Bond films to date, together in a Blu-ray box-set. The package includes a 24th space for SPECTRE and, for the first time, digital copies of the collection will be included, (UK & US only). 
Also included in The Ultimate James Bond Collection is a new bonus disc with the full 90-minute documentary “Everything or Nothing,” further bonus materials, and a pocket-sized book featuring the best posters from DR. NO to SPECTRE.

I ONLY NEED ONE: Help Crowdfund The New Bond-Inspired Action Short

With Spectre making headway over at Sony, I wouldn't be surprised if the internet started turning out with more and more fan-inspired shorts and test fights attributed to the longstanding 007 franchise. Point in fact, Colin Emmerson's Sapphire is an example of this, and now we're onto a new crowdfunding campaign this month ahead of the hopeful shortfilm production, I Only Need One.
Action actor and stuntman Andrew J. Neis is spearheading the project on Indiegogo to advance the directorial debut of Matthew Salanoa for an inspired look into Ian Fleming's cinematic universe filled with mystery, intrigue and danger at every turn. For Salanoa's take, it goes a little something like this:
Our short, "I ONLY NEED ONE" will feature a HEROIC SPY (Neis), who wakes on a mysterious island all alone, save for an invitation to a duel. As he looks for signs of civilization, he is met with sniper fire, an axe-wielding mad man, and is ultimately led into a trap.
The trap: A funhouse designed with rotating mirrors, puppets packing heat, and flashing lights -- all to scare, disorient and trick our hero into wasting his precious six shots. All this, the work of our EVIL VILLIAN (Richard Mills), who carries a one-shot pistol made of pure gold -- the GOLD GUN
